Nestled on the edge of Bromley, Penge and Cator blends leafy streets with a handful of tight-knit pubs and community halls that host open-mic nights, jazz jams and acoustic sessions. The area’s music scene is quietly eclectic—weekend spots like the local café open their doors to acoustic folk while nearby halls sometimes host brass ensembles or hip-hop showcases. This diversity means Penge and Cator Rehearsal Studios attract drummers, brass quintets, electronic artists and everything in between. You’ll feel the friendly suburban vibe even while you’re deep in your mix, with green spaces like Alexandra Recreation Ground just around the corner for a quick break. Across Penge and Cator you’ll find independent rehearsal studios tucked above high-street shops and purpose-built spaces that cater to back-to-back bookings. Rooms typically come equipped with PA systems, mics, monitors and adjustable lighting, and many offer flexible late-night access for spontaneous sessions. Engineers and studio managers here know the local community, so you’re more likely to meet fellow musicians swapping tips on session drummers or where to grab a post-rehearsal pizza. Getting here is easy: Penge East and Penge West stations link you to central London in under 20 minutes, and multiple bus routes serve the high street. When you need coffee, snacks or gear supplies, there are plenty of cafés, takeaways and music shops within walking distance.
